Understanding Blood Sugar Units: mg/dL vs. mmol/L

Before we delve into the conversion, let's clarify what these units represent:

  • mg/dL (milligrams per deciliter): This unit measures the mass (in milligrams) of glucose in a specific volume of blood (a deciliter, which is one-tenth of a liter). This is the most commonly used unit in the United States.

  • mmol/L (millimoles per liter): This unit measures the molar concentration (in millimoles) of glucose in a liter of blood. This is the standard unit used in many other countries, including Canada, the UK, and other parts of Europe.

Knowing the units your blood glucose test reports is the first step in understanding the results. It impacts how you interpret the data in order to adjust any necessary changes in lifestyle, diet, or treatment plans.

Converting mg/dL to mmol/L and Vice Versa

Here's a straightforward guide for converting between these units:

  • To convert mg/dL to mmol/L: Divide the mg/dL value by 18.
  • To convert mmol/L to mg/dL: Multiply the mmol/L value by 18.

For example:

  • If your blood sugar is 100 mg/dL, the equivalent in mmol/L is 100 / 18 = 5.56 mmol/L.
  • If your blood sugar is 7 mmol/L, the equivalent in mg/dL is 7 * 18 = 126 mg/dL.

Blood Sugar Levels: What's Normal?

Knowing how to convert between units is helpful, but understanding what constitutes a normal blood sugar range is equally important. These values may vary slightly depending on the guidelines provided by your healthcare provider, and depending on other health conditions. But generally, the following ranges are considered standard:

Category mg/dL mmol/L
Fasting (after at least 8 hours) 70-99 mg/dL 3.9-5.5 mmol/L
2 hours after a meal Less than 140 mg/dL Less than 7.8 mmol/L
HbA1c (average over 2-3 months) N/A Less than 5.7% (This is a percentage, not mg/dL or mmol/L)
  • Fasting Blood Sugar: Measured after an overnight fast. High fasting blood sugar levels may indicate impaired glucose tolerance or diabetes.
  • Postprandial Blood Sugar: Measured two hours after eating a meal. Helps determine how well your body processes glucose after food intake.
  • HbA1c: A measure of your average blood sugar levels over the past 2-3 months. It provides a longer-term perspective on your blood sugar control.

If your blood glucose levels consistently fall outside these ranges, you should consult your doctor for further evaluation and management.

Factors Affecting Blood Sugar Levels

Various factors can influence your blood glucose levels, including:

  • Diet: Consuming high-carbohydrate foods can raise blood sugar.
  • Physical Activity: Exercise can help lower blood sugar by increasing insulin sensitivity.
  • Stress: Stress hormones can increase blood sugar.
  • Medications: Certain medications, such as steroids, can affect blood glucose.
  • Illness: Infections can temporarily raise blood sugar levels.
  • Dehydration: May contribute to increase blood sugar values.

Tips for Managing Blood Sugar

Here are some actionable tips to help you maintain healthy blood glucose levels:

  • Eat a Balanced Diet: Focus on whole grains, lean proteins, and plenty of fruits and vegetables.
  • Exercise Regularly: Aim for at least 30 minutes of moderate-intensity exercise most days of the week.
  • Monitor Blood Sugar: Regularly check your blood sugar levels, especially if you have diabetes.
  • Stay Hydrated: Drink plenty of water throughout the day.
  • Manage Stress: Practice relaxation techniques such as yoga or meditation.
  • Get Enough Sleep: Aim for 7-8 hours of quality sleep per night.

By adopting these lifestyle changes, you can significantly improve your blood sugar control.

When to See a Doctor

It's important to consult a healthcare professional if you experience any of the following:

  • Consistently high or low blood sugar readings.
  • Symptoms of diabetes, such as frequent urination, excessive thirst, and unexplained weight loss.
  • Difficulty managing your blood glucose levels despite following a healthy lifestyle.
  • Any concerns about your blood glucose readings or diabetes management plan.

The Importance of Regular Monitoring

Regular blood sugar monitoring is an essential component of diabetes management. It allows you to track your progress, make informed decisions about your diet and medication, and prevent potential complications. Whether you use a traditional glucometer or a continuous blood glucose monitor (CGM), consistent monitoring is key to maintaining stable blood glucose levels.
